OdbcConnection.ConnectionTimeout Własność
Definicja
Ważny
Niektóre informacje dotyczą produktów przedpremierowych, które mogą zostać znacznie zmodyfikowane przed premierą. Microsoft nie udziela żadnych gwarancji, ani wyraźnych, ani domniemanych, dotyczących informacji podanych tutaj.
Pobiera lub ustawia czas oczekiwania (w sekundach) podczas próby nawiązania połączenia przed zakończeniem próby i wygenerowaniem błędu.
public:
property int ConnectionTimeout { int get(); void set(int value); };
public int ConnectionTimeout { get; set; }
member this.ConnectionTimeout : int with get, set
Public Property ConnectionTimeout As Integer
Wartość nieruchomości
Czas w sekundach oczekiwania na otwarcie połączenia. Wartość domyślna to 15 sekund.
Wyjątki
Zestaw wartości jest mniejszy niż 0.
Uwagi
W przeciwieństwie do dostawców danych .NET Framework dla SQL Server i OLE DB dostawca danych .NET Framework dla ODBC nie obsługuje ustawiania tej właściwości jako wartości parametry połączenia, ponieważ nie jest to prawidłowe słowo kluczowe połączenia ODBC. Aby określić limit czasu połączenia, ustaw ConnectionTimeout właściwość przed wywołaniem metody Open. Jest to równoważne ustawieniu atrybutu SQL_ATTR_LOGIN_TIMOUT ODBC SQLSetConnectAttr .